移动互联前端架构:流畅度优化与性能控制实践
|
移动互联前端架构的流畅度优化与性能控制是提升用户体验的关键环节。随着移动端设备的多样化和网络环境的复杂化,前端开发者需要在保证功能完整性的前提下,尽可能减少资源加载时间,提高页面响应速度。 优化策略可以从资源加载开始。通过压缩图片、合并CSS和JavaScript文件、使用懒加载技术等方式,可以有效降低初始加载时间。同时,采用CDN加速和预加载机制,也能显著改善用户首次访问时的体验。 在代码层面,避免过多的DOM操作和频繁的重排重绘是提升性能的重要手段。合理使用虚拟滚动、节流与防抖函数,能够减少不必要的计算,使应用运行更加平滑。合理管理内存,及时释放不再使用的对象,也有助于降低内存占用。
AI绘图,仅供参考 性能监控同样不可忽视。借助浏览器开发者工具或第三方性能分析工具,可以实时跟踪页面加载时间、渲染性能以及内存使用情况。这些数据为后续优化提供了依据,帮助开发者精准定位问题所在。在实际开发中,应结合项目需求选择合适的优化方案。例如,对于内容较多的列表页,可优先考虑分页加载或无限滚动;而对于交互复杂的单页应用,则需注重组件的复用性和状态管理的合理性。 持续的性能测试和迭代优化是保持应用高质量运行的保障。通过A/B测试、用户行为分析等手段,不断调整优化策略,才能适应不断变化的用户需求和技术环境。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号